[h1] One of best visual novels I've read[/h1]
[h3]But so few people bought this game, that it still has a mark on steam page with "steam is learning about the game", after almost five years! This is a crime![/h3]
I will be honest: Untill this game, I had a prejudice toward non-japanese visual novels. I always thought they were worse than japanese ones. And their maximum level is "not bad". Because of it, I pushed this vn far in backlog. But due to some reasons, I've read it now. And I am very impressed.
There is recommend route order. First two routes are not that special. But next three are very good. I was totally invested. Time passed by in the blink of an eye while reading. And I got teary eyed during one particular scene at the end. I love when visual novels drive me to such strong emotions.
There is romance, but story doesn't focus on it. Don't expect something like dating sim.
Coffee play big part in the story. But you don't need to be coffee fan to enjoy this vn.
Nice soundtrack! Not very much songs, but some of it I will definetly add to my playlist. For example song called Caffeinated.
So, I am no more prejudiced toward non japanese visual novels.
